Just wanted to share something that I am sure you all know, but i have been shocked by - I am doing a low fat diet and have really reduced my fat intake to about 15 - 20g a day. The biggest shock has been bread. I tried the Danish stuff (0.5g per slice), which was like eating air and I was starving within 30 mins of eating any, so have researched all the breads I like from our local shop and there is a HUGE difference. From 0.6g per slice

, up to 3.9g!! One sandwich and half my daily allowance has gone before I put anything into it!!!
